Analysis

In a truly unconventional showdown, Basementality Battles presented a 'mirror match' featuring Shazaam battling himself. This unique concept immediately captured attention, with Shazaam stepping up to the plate to deliver a performance that was both comedic and surprisingly personal. He skillfully navigated the self-referential nature of the battle, landing clever jabs and even touching on childhood anecdotes that resonated with parts of the audience.

Despite the innovative premise, fan reactions were a mixed bag. While many praised Shazaam's execution, hailing it as one of his best showings and celebrating the humor, some viewers felt the battle lacked consistent engagement. The energy from the live crowd was also a point of discussion, with several comments noting a perceived quietness.

Nevertheless, Shazaam's ability to carry the entire battle on his shoulders, maintaining a confident and entertaining persona, ultimately swayed the majority of the fan vote in his favor, proving that sometimes, the toughest opponent is yourself.
